Sandeep Govil has a diverse and extensive work experience spanning over several companies and industries. Sandeep currently holds the position of Head of North America Revenue Management at Hapag-Lloyd AG since June 2019. Prior to that, they served as the Executive Director of Finance and Strategy, Global BI/Data Science at The Estée Lauder Companies Inc. from 2018 to 2019. Sandeep also worked as the VP of Strategy and Analytics at NBCUniversal from 2014 to 2017. Sandeep has also held roles at INTTRA, Wyndham Worldwide, Cendant Corp, Delta Air Lines, and Sabre Corporation, where they gained experience in various areas such as corporate strategy, revenue management, and business analytics. Throughout their career, Sandeep has demonstrated expertise in data-driven strategies, revenue growth, and customer growth.
Sandeep Govil has an extensive education history. Sandeep holds a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) degree in Machine Learning & Operations Research from Arizona State University. Prior to their Ph.D., they completed a Bachelor of Technology (B.Tech.) in Mechanical Engineering from the Indian Institute of Technology, Kanpur. Later, they pursued a Master of Business Administration (M.B.A.) with a specialization in Strategy and Marketing from the University of Louisiana. In addition to their academic degrees, they obtained a certification as a Financial Risk Manager from GARP in June 2003.

With a fleet of 257 modern container ships and a total transport capacity of 1.8 million TEU, Hapag-Lloyd is one of the world’s leading liner shipping companies. The company has around 13,900 employees and 418 offices in 137 countries. Hapag-Lloyd has a container capacity of approximately 3 million TEU – including one of the largest and most modern fleets of reefer containers. A total of 129 liner services worldwide ensure fast and reliable connections between more than 600 ports on all the continents. Hapag-Lloyd is one of the leading operators in the Transatlantic, Middle East, Latin America and Intra-America trades.
